As the accusations and counter accusations unfold over alleged sexual harassment in Nigeria's National Assembly, the Senator representing Kogi Central at the Senate, Natasha Akpoti-Uduaghan, has told the wife of the Senate President, Godswill Akpabio, Unoma, to stay out of the allegations of sexual harassment and intimidation she made against her husband.
According to the lawmaker, her motion was denied because she refused to yield to the Senate president's sexual advances towards her.
The Kogi-born senator opened up on the allegation on Friday while fielding questions on the Arise Television Morning Show programme where she accused the Senate President of the said alleged sexual harassment.
However, in her reactions, wife of the Senate President, Unoma said Sen. Natasha's accusations are basedless and an attempt to drag her husband's name to the mud.
Unoma stated on Friday that Natasha is only “creating content for personal gains”.
